(Official Name: National Identity /国民身份党) (Commonly known as National Identity Party) Member of the Constitutional Stability Coalition (CSC) National Identity /国民身份党 (Guómín shēnfèn dǎng) was established as a right-wing political party by several conservative activists to fight against the cultural, societal and political erosion of traditional Jieun values by dominant groups within the political system of Yingdala . Political Ideology: Jienfushism, Yingdalan Conservatism, Nationalism, Secretary General: Xi Yu Luan Assistant Secretary He Lui National Assembly Delegation Leader: Xi Yu Luan Organisational Wing: National Executive Committee Policy Think-Tank: Values & Heritage Foundation ======== Prominent Individuals Associated With National Identity Huan Lu Shan (Prime Minister of Yingdala) (October 4908 - June 4918) |
